WHU team shines in Space Law Moot Court
Three students from WHU clinched second place in the Asia-Pacific Rounds of the "Manfred Lachs International Space Law Moot Court Competition 2019", held at Amity Law School in India. Teams from forty-seven countries participated in this competition. WHUer at Confucius Institutes
Wuhan University has co-founded four Confucius Institutes (CIs) with Université Paris Diderot in France, the University of Pittsburgh in the USA, the University of Duisburg-Essen in Germany, and the University of Aberdeen in Great Britain respectively.
